Curso Arduino Terminado

download Curso Arduino Terminado

of 53

Transcript of Curso Arduino Terminado

  • 8/12/2019 Curso Arduino Terminado

    1/53

  • 8/12/2019 Curso Arduino Terminado

    2/53

    que es hardware y software libre ?

    es la divulgacin del conocimiento el cual puede sermodificado, usado y distribuido sin fines comerciales y sincosto alguno para el usuario.

    Creative Common??. Lawrence Lessig 2002 el conocimiento debe ser libre. Some rights reserved, All rights reserved

  • 8/12/2019 Curso Arduino Terminado

    3/53

    que es arduino ?

    Instituto Italiano de Diseo Interactivo ,2005,Massimo Banzi bar Bar di Re Arduino Para su creacin participaron alumnos que desarrollaban sus t

    como Hernando Barragan (Colombia) quien desarrollo laplataforma de programacin Wiring con la cual se programa emicrocontrolador.

    A la fecha se han vendido ms de 250 mil placas en todo elmundo sin contar las versiones clones y compatibles.

  • 8/12/2019 Curso Arduino Terminado

    4/53

  • 8/12/2019 Curso Arduino Terminado

    5/53

    boards

  • 8/12/2019 Curso Arduino Terminado

    6/53

  • 8/12/2019 Curso Arduino Terminado

    7/53

    shields

  • 8/12/2019 Curso Arduino Terminado

    8/53

  • 8/12/2019 Curso Arduino Terminado

    9/53

    arduIno uno

  • 8/12/2019 Curso Arduino Terminado

    10/53

    Descargar el software

    http://arduino.cc/en/Main/Software

  • 8/12/2019 Curso Arduino Terminado

    11/53

    como instalarlo ?

  • 8/12/2019 Curso Arduino Terminado

    12/53

    como instalarlo ?

  • 8/12/2019 Curso Arduino Terminado

    13/53

    como instalarlo ?

  • 8/12/2019 Curso Arduino Terminado

    14/53

  • 8/12/2019 Curso Arduino Terminado

    15/53

    Referencia del lenguaje

  • 8/12/2019 Curso Arduino Terminado

    16/53

    Referencia del lenguaje

  • 8/12/2019 Curso Arduino Terminado

    17/53

    Hola mundo

  • 8/12/2019 Curso Arduino Terminado

    18/53

  • 8/12/2019 Curso Arduino Terminado

    19/53

    boton

  • 8/12/2019 Curso Arduino Terminado

    20/53

    boton

  • 8/12/2019 Curso Arduino Terminado

    21/53

    PROGRAMAR EL CIRCUITOAUTO FANTSTICO

    ejercicio

  • 8/12/2019 Curso Arduino Terminado

    22/53

    Auto fantstico

    HACER EL PROGRAMA DEL AUFANTSTICO CONTROLADO PORBOTN

  • 8/12/2019 Curso Arduino Terminado

    23/53

    auto fantastico-boton

  • 8/12/2019 Curso Arduino Terminado

    24/53

    pwm

    Si tenemos un voltaje de 9v y lo modulamos conduty cycle del 10%, obtenemos 0.9V de seal analde salida.

  • 8/12/2019 Curso Arduino Terminado

    25/53

    ejercicio 5

  • 8/12/2019 Curso Arduino Terminado

    26/53

    ejercicio 5

  • 8/12/2019 Curso Arduino Terminado

    27/53

    Como controlamosun motor dc ?

  • 8/12/2019 Curso Arduino Terminado

    28/53

  • 8/12/2019 Curso Arduino Terminado

    29/53

  • 8/12/2019 Curso Arduino Terminado

    30/53

    ejercicio 6

  • 8/12/2019 Curso Arduino Terminado

    31/53

    Ejercicio 6

  • 8/12/2019 Curso Arduino Terminado

    32/53

    ejercicio 7

  • 8/12/2019 Curso Arduino Terminado

    33/53

    ejercicio 7

  • 8/12/2019 Curso Arduino Terminado

    34/53

    Comunicacin usb

    HID ( por sus siglas en ingles, HumanInterface Device). sistema operativo

    MSD ( por sus siglas en ingles, MassStorage Device Class ). bulk ypor interrupcin

    CDC (Por sus siglas en ingles,Communications Device Class ). USB enuna transmisin Serial

  • 8/12/2019 Curso Arduino Terminado

    35/53

    enviar datos usb

  • 8/12/2019 Curso Arduino Terminado

    36/53

    enviar datos usb

  • 8/12/2019 Curso Arduino Terminado

    37/53

    recibir datos usb

  • 8/12/2019 Curso Arduino Terminado

    38/53

    recibir datos usb

  • 8/12/2019 Curso Arduino Terminado

    39/53

    processing

    basado en Java Ben Fry y Casey Reas

    Licencia Pblica General de GNU orientada principalmente a proteger lalibre distribucin, modificacin y usode software.

  • 8/12/2019 Curso Arduino Terminado

    40/53

    El entorno

  • 8/12/2019 Curso Arduino Terminado

    41/53

    referencias

  • 8/12/2019 Curso Arduino Terminado

    42/53

    referencias

  • 8/12/2019 Curso Arduino Terminado

    43/53

    Ejercicio

  • 8/12/2019 Curso Arduino Terminado

    44/53

    Ejercicio 2

  • 8/12/2019 Curso Arduino Terminado

    45/53

    PROCESSING-ARDUINO

  • 8/12/2019 Curso Arduino Terminado

    46/53

    Hacer que al dar unclick en processingse encienda el led

    ARDUINO-PROCESSING

  • 8/12/2019 Curso Arduino Terminado

    47/53

    ARDUINO-PROCESSING

  • 8/12/2019 Curso Arduino Terminado

    48/53

    ARDUINO-PROCESSING

  • 8/12/2019 Curso Arduino Terminado

    49/53

    ARDUINO-PROCESSING

  • 8/12/2019 Curso Arduino Terminado

    50/53

    ARDUINO-PROCESSING

  • 8/12/2019 Curso Arduino Terminado

    51/53

    ARDUINO-PROCESSING

    O OC SS G

  • 8/12/2019 Curso Arduino Terminado

    52/53

    ARDUINO-PROCESSING

  • 8/12/2019 Curso Arduino Terminado

    53/53

    !!!! Gracias